在数字化时代,信息如同汪洋大海,浩瀚无边。如何在这片信息海洋中精准地找到我们所需的知识和资料,成为了每个人都需要面对的挑战。而大模型召回技术,正是为了解决这一挑战而诞生的。今天,就让我们一起来揭开大模型召回技术的神秘面纱,探索其如何精准检索,解锁信息宝藏的新篇章。
大模型召回技术概述
大模型召回技术,顾名思义,是指利用大规模的模型对海量数据进行检索,以实现对特定信息的精准定位。这种技术广泛应用于搜索引擎、推荐系统、问答系统等领域,其核心目标在于提高检索的准确性和效率。
1. 大模型召回技术的基本原理
大模型召回技术的基本原理是将用户查询与数据库中的文档进行匹配,通过计算匹配度来确定文档的相关性,从而实现精准检索。具体来说,主要包括以下几个步骤:
- 预处理:对用户查询和文档进行预处理,包括分词、去停用词、词性标注等,以提高检索的准确性。
- 特征提取:提取用户查询和文档的关键特征,如TF-IDF、Word2Vec等,以便进行后续的匹配计算。
- 相似度计算:计算用户查询与文档之间的相似度,常用的方法有余弦相似度、欧氏距离等。
- 排序:根据相似度对文档进行排序,将最相关的文档排在前面。
2. 大模型召回技术的优势
相较于传统的检索技术,大模型召回技术具有以下优势:
- 准确性高:通过深度学习等先进算法,大模型召回技术能够更准确地匹配用户查询和文档,提高检索的准确性。
- 效率高:大模型召回技术能够在短时间内处理海量数据,提高检索效率。
- 可扩展性强:大模型召回技术可以方便地扩展到不同的应用场景,如搜索引擎、推荐系统等。
精准检索的关键技术
为了实现精准检索,大模型召回技术需要借助一系列关键技术,以下列举几个关键点:
1. 深度学习算法
深度学习算法是支撑大模型召回技术的重要基石。通过深度学习,模型可以自动学习到用户查询和文档的特征,从而提高检索的准确性。常见的深度学习算法包括:
- 卷积神经网络(CNN):适用于文本分类、情感分析等任务。
- 循环神经网络(RNN):适用于序列数据处理,如自然语言处理。
- 长短期记忆网络(LSTM):RNN的一种变体,适用于处理长序列数据。
2. 语义理解
语义理解是提高检索准确性的关键。通过理解用户查询和文档的语义,模型可以更好地匹配相关文档。常见的语义理解技术包括:
- 词嵌入:将词语映射到高维空间,以便进行语义计算。
- 句子嵌入:将句子映射到高维空间,以便进行语义计算。
- 知识图谱:利用知识图谱中的实体和关系,进行语义计算。
3. 个性化推荐
个性化推荐是一种基于用户兴趣和行为的推荐技术。通过分析用户的历史行为和兴趣,模型可以推荐用户可能感兴趣的内容,从而提高检索的准确性。
大模型召回技术的应用案例
大模型召回技术在各个领域都有广泛的应用,以下列举几个典型案例:
1. 搜索引擎
搜索引擎是应用大模型召回技术最典型的场景。通过深度学习等算法,搜索引擎可以实现对海量网页的精准检索,为用户提供更好的搜索体验。
2. 推荐系统
推荐系统利用大模型召回技术,根据用户的历史行为和兴趣,为用户推荐相关内容,如电影、音乐、商品等。
3. 问答系统
问答系统利用大模型召回技术,根据用户的提问,从海量文档中检索出最相关的答案。
总结
大模型召回技术作为信息检索领域的一项重要技术,在提高检索准确性和效率方面发挥着重要作用。随着深度学习、语义理解等技术的不断发展,大模型召回技术将不断优化,为用户提供更加精准、高效的信息检索服务。在未来,大模型召回技术有望在更多领域得到应用,解锁信息宝藏的新篇章。
